The 160cc premium sporty commuter segment is currently the most sought-after motorcycle segment in the Indian market. That's because they look good, are very feature-loaded, offer punchy performance, a decent mileage and are pretty affordable too. Now, we have a lot of motorcycles in this 160cc segment, ranging from the much-loved TVS Apache RTR 160 4V to the Bajaj Pulsar Pulsar NS 160 and also the Japanese folks like the Suzuki Gixxer, Yamaha FZ-S V3, Honda X-Blade 160, etc. The Hero Xtreme 160R is the latest entrant in this segment and on-paper this new kid seems really good.
